Transaction 959935d4312048d117fe6c6640d597b656f4eef5d16ae541b95e2f2aba885f96
1 Input
2 Outputs
- 959935d4312048d117fe6c6640d597b656f4eef5d16ae541b95e2f2aba885f96:0
- 959935d4312048d117fe6c6640d597b656f4eef5d16ae541b95e2f2aba885f96:1
value 1826
address 1F3XRGhzwo9sWbAkHTBkQi6n4JQyNR2fnc
value 446586
address 1LbUYxhZgHbLWJu1ZWzGNryc4Y5UgLsRA